Hello,
Is it possible to insert formula columns into a Pivot Table? If you have counts of insurance quotes and bound policies within the same Pivot Table, could you have another formula column within the Pivot table to show the percentage of quotes that have become policies? We're currently adding another column to the right of the Pivot table, but this is clumsy, and this added column easily falls out of alignment with the Pivot table, depending on how many records you have from one data Refresh to another. Thank you. -- Pat Dools |
